Records management in information-age government<br />
1.26 Contextual <strong>and</strong> structural information is needed to make documents<br />
underst<strong>and</strong>able <strong>and</strong> usable as <strong>records</strong>. Electronic documents lack the ‘built-in’<br />
physical characteristics <strong>of</strong> conventional <strong>records</strong> that help to establish the<br />
relationship between a record <strong>and</strong> its functional <strong>and</strong> administrative context.<br />
The information contained in a paper record is represented externally as marks<br />
on a page, <strong>and</strong> requires no further technology (beyond an individual<br />
underst<strong>and</strong>ing <strong>of</strong> the language <strong>and</strong> notation used) to interpret it; <strong>and</strong> it will<br />
normally be collated with other paper <strong>records</strong> in a physical file or folder as a<br />
matter <strong>of</strong> course.<br />
1.27 In contrast, the information within an <strong>electronic</strong> record is represented<br />
internally by an abstract machine-based code, <strong>and</strong> can only be rendered visible<br />
by a sophisticated technology which can read <strong>and</strong> interpret that code <strong>and</strong><br />
display it in a human-readable form. Once the ability to read the code is lost,<br />
then the record becomes unusable, perhaps for ever. In addition, such <strong>electronic</strong><br />
documents are <strong>of</strong>ten not stored in meaningful groupings which can show their<br />
context <strong>of</strong> use; rather, reliance is placed on search technologies to seek <strong>and</strong><br />
retrieve relevant documents from a large amorphous collection, with no<br />
indication <strong>of</strong> the links or associations between individual documents.<br />
1.28 An <strong>electronic</strong> record may also be multi-layered <strong>and</strong> multi-dimensional, so<br />
that it can be displayed in different ways for different purposes. A spreadsheet,<br />
for example, can be shown as a set <strong>of</strong> formulae <strong>and</strong> the initial data on which<br />
they work, or as the figures which result from the formula calculations; both<br />
these ‘views’ are relevant to an underst<strong>and</strong>ing <strong>of</strong> the full significance <strong>of</strong> the<br />
spreadsheet. The tables in a relational database can routinely be combined in<br />
many different ways to present different ‘user views’ <strong>of</strong> the same underlying<br />
data.<br />
1.29 Records managers must ask: which <strong>of</strong> these ‘views’ need to be preserved to<br />
maintain a full underst<strong>and</strong>ing <strong>of</strong> the record <strong>and</strong> its context: the view as<br />
presented to the decision-maker on the screen, or the complete contents <strong>of</strong> the<br />
database which was available? How much <strong>of</strong> a website document should be<br />
preserved - the main text only, the text <strong>and</strong> any hypertext links, or these<br />
together with the text to which they link?<br />
